The Senior Compensation Consultant will lead the design, administration, and continuous improvement of compensation programs for a well-established, employee-focused organization. This role leverages market data, internal equity analysis, and business insights to deliver competitive, equitable, and sustainable pay practices that support talent strategy and long-term business objectives. The position partners closely with HR leadership, Finance, and business leaders to develop compensation solutions that attract, retain, and reward top talent.

Roles & Responsibilities :
  • Lead the design, administration, and continuous improvement of the organization's compensation philosophy, salary structures, job architecture, and related programs to support market competitiveness and internal equity
  • Partner with HR Business Partners and business leaders to evaluate new and existing positions, conduct market benchmarking, recommend job levels and pay grades, and provide compensation guidance
  • Lead the annual market review process, including salary survey participation, market analysis, competitive positioning assessments, and salary structure recommendations
  • Develop and oversee a consistent approach to internal equity analysis, identify areas of concern, recommend corrective actions, and educate leaders on equitable pay practices
  • Administer company wide incentive compensation programs, including short-term and long-term incentive plans, supporting program design, modeling, communication, and governance
  • Lead the annual merit review cycle from planning through execution, including system configuration, communications, training, approvals, data validation, employee communications, and payroll coordination
  • Partner with senior HR leadership to support executive compensation programs, including base salary, incentive compensation, and related analyses and recommendations
  • Configure, maintain, and continuously improve compensation-related processes, reporting, and controls within Workday Advanced Compensation
  • Collaborate with HR leadership and Finance on annual budget planning, workforce cost projections, salary increase modeling, and incentive forecasting
  • Prepare compensation analyses, dashboards, models, and executive-ready presentations that translate complex data into actionable recommendations
  • Maintain compensation policies, procedures, documentation, and employee-facing communications, including Total Rewards communications and statements
  • Monitor compensation-related laws and regulations and support compliance efforts, audits, and implementation of regulatory changes
  • Build trusted relationships across the organization and provide practical, consultative compensation expertise to leaders and stakeholders
